Automatización de procesos: Más allá de lo evidente con APIs.

Automatización de procesos: Más allá de lo evidente con APIs.

Automatización de Procesos: Más allá de lo Evidente con APIs

La automatización de procesos mediante APIs va más allá de la mera conexión de sistemas. Implica una estrategia que optimiza la eficiencia operativa, reduce errores y libera recursos. A continuación, exploramos los enfoques clave para lograrlo:

  • Integración Directa de APIs

    Conecta sistemas directamente usando sus interfaces de programación. Permite un control granular y una comunicación fluida entre aplicaciones, optimizando flujos de trabajo específicos sin intermediarios adicionales. Ideal para escenarios de alta personalización.

  • Plataformas de Integración (iPaaS)

    Utiliza soluciones basadas en la nube para gestionar múltiples conexiones API. Simplifica la orquestación de procesos complejos, ofreciendo herramientas visuales y conectores preconstruidos. Acelera el desarrollo y reduce la carga de mantenimiento para equipos técnicos.

  • Automatización Robótica de Procesos (RPA) con APIs

    Combina la capacidad de los bots RPA para interactuar con interfaces de usuario con la potencia de las APIs. Mejora la robustez de la automatización, permitiendo a los bots acceder a datos y funcionalidades internas de las aplicaciones de manera más eficiente.

Criterios de Evaluación para la Automatización

Al considerar la implementación de soluciones de automatización con APIs, es fundamental evaluar diversos aspectos para asegurar la elección más adecuada. Preste atención a los siguientes puntos:

  • Complejidad de Implementación

    Evalúa el esfuerzo técnico para configurar y lanzar. Considera la necesidad de desarrolladores y la curva de aprendizaje asociada a cada método.

  • Escalabilidad y Flexibilidad

    Analiza la capacidad para crecer y adaptarse a cambios. Importa la facilidad para añadir nuevas integraciones o modificar las existentes con el tiempo.

  • Costos Operativos y de Mantenimiento

    Examina los gastos de licencias, infraestructura y personal. Es clave para la sostenibilidad y gestión continua de las integraciones a largo plazo.

  • Seguridad y Fiabilidad

    Evalúa la protección de datos y la estabilidad del sistema. Crucial para procesos ininterrumpidos y la seguridad de información sensible de la empresa.

Análisis Comparativo de Enfoques

La integración directa de APIs ofrece un control máximo, pero su complejidad de implementación puede ser elevada. Requiere conocimiento técnico profundo y desarrollo personalizado para cada conexión. Aunque es muy flexible, la escalabilidad puede volverse un desafío al añadir múltiples sistemas, aumentando la carga de mantenimiento y el tiempo de respuesta para nuevas funcionalidades. Este enfoque demanda recursos internos significativos.

En cuanto a los costos operativos y de mantenimiento, la integración directa puede parecer más económica inicialmente al evitar licencias de plataformas. Sin embargo, los gastos de personal especializado y el tiempo dedicado a la resolución de problemas pueden ser significativos. La seguridad y fiabilidad dependen enteramente de la calidad del código y la infraestructura propia, exigiendo altos estándares internos de control.

Las plataformas de integración (iPaaS) simplifican la complejidad de implementación con herramientas visuales y conectores preconstruidos, reduciendo la necesidad de programación intensiva. Su diseño intrínseco favorece una excelente escalabilidad y flexibilidad, permitiendo añadir nuevas integraciones y flujos de trabajo con relativa facilidad, adaptándose al crecimiento del negocio sin reestructuraciones mayores y con agilidad.

Los costos operativos y de mantenimiento de iPaaS incluyen tarifas de suscripción, pero a menudo compensan al reducir la necesidad de personal de desarrollo y la infraestructura interna. Respecto a la seguridad y fiabilidad, estas plataformas suelen ofrecer robustas características de seguridad, cumplimiento normativo y alta disponibilidad, gestionadas por el proveedor, lo que disminuye la preocupación para CypherNestxolo.

La automatización robótica de procesos (RPA) con APIs presenta una complejidad de implementación intermedia. Si bien los bots RPA son fáciles de configurar para tareas repetitivas, integrar APIs requiere un conocimiento más técnico. La escalabilidad y flexibilidad mejoran significativamente al usar APIs, ya que los bots pueden acceder a datos internos de forma más estable, aunque la gestión de muchos bots puede ser compleja.

Los costos operativos y de mantenimiento de RPA con APIs implican licencias de RPA y el esfuerzo de integración de APIs. Puede ser costoso si se implementa a gran escala, pero ofrece un retorno rápido en procesos específicos. La seguridad y fiabilidad se fortalecen al combinar la resiliencia de las APIs con la capacidad de los bots, reduciendo errores y garantizando que los datos se manejen de forma segura y consistente en todo momento.

Recomendaciones Estratégicas para su Empresa

Para organizaciones con equipos de desarrollo robustos y requisitos muy específicos, la integración directa de APIs es ideal. Permite un control total sobre cada conexión y la máxima personalización. Es la elección preferida cuando la necesidad de una solución a medida supera la complejidad de su implementación y mantenimiento interno, justificando la inversión en recursos especializados.

Las plataformas iPaaS son excelentes para empresas que buscan agilizar la integración de múltiples sistemas con una menor dependencia de desarrollo interno. Son perfectas para escalar rápidamente, gestionar una diversidad de aplicaciones y asegurar una alta disponibilidad y seguridad sin incurrir en grandes gastos de infraestructura propia, facilitando una rápida adopción.

Si su empresa ya utiliza RPA o busca automatizar procesos que involucran tanto interfaces de usuario como sistemas backend, la combinación de RPA con APIs es una solución potente. Mejora la eficiencia y fiabilidad de los bots, permitiéndoles interactuar con sistemas de manera más profunda y robusta, optimizando tareas complejas y de alto volumen de forma segura.

La elección del método adecuado depende de la madurez tecnológica de la organización, la complejidad de los procesos a automatizar y los recursos disponibles. CypherNestxolo recomienda evaluar cuidadosamente cada opción, considerando no solo el costo inicial sino también la escalabilidad a largo plazo y la capacidad de mantenimiento para asegurar el éxito continuo.

Comentarios ( 4 )

Jorge Peña

Este artículo ofrece una visión muy clara y estructurada de las opciones de automatización con APIs. La comparación es muy útil para entender las implicaciones de cada enfoque.

Zoe Arias

Me pareció interesante la mención de RPA con APIs. No había considerado esa combinación como una alternativa robusta para procesos más complejos.

Agustina Benítez

¡Gracias por tu comentario! Nos alegra que la estructura te haya resultado beneficiosa. Nuestro objetivo es precisamente ofrecer claridad en temas complejos.

Gustavo Rivas

Es una combinación poderosa que a menudo se subestima. Combina lo mejor de ambos mundos para optimizar la interacción con sistemas. ¡Gracias por leer!

Deja un comentario